Understanding Chronic Kidney Disease in Cats
What do kidneys do and why does CKD happen?

Healthy kidneys filter waste, regulate electrolytes, control blood pressure, and produce erythropoietin (EPO) for red blood cells. Aging reduces nephron count (functional kidney units), and progressive damage is irreversible.

The 75% threshold creates a diagnostic challenge: remaining nephrons compensate brilliantly until they exhaust. Blood work appears normal while disease silently progresses for months. Cornell Feline Health Center research confirms cats show no symptoms during early stages when intervention proves most effective.

How Do I Know If My Cat Has Kidney Disease?
What are the early warning signs and how is CKD diagnosed?

Early signs include increased thirst and urination, weight loss despite normal appetite, vomiting (particularly morning), lethargy, poor coat quality, and uremic breath with ammonia-like odor.

Veterinarians diagnose through blood work (creatinine, BUN, phosphorus), SDMA testing (detects dysfunction earlier than creatinine, at 40% loss vs. 75%), urinalysis (concentration ability, protein levels), urine protein-to-creatinine ratio (UPC), and blood pressure monitoring.

What is the IRIS staging system and why does it matter?

The International Renal Interest Society or IRIS staging system categorizes disease severity:

  • Stage 1: Creatinine <1.6 mg/dL, minimal symptoms, diagnosed through proteinuria or imaging 
  • Stage 2: Creatinine 1.6-2.8 mg/dL, first symptoms appear, start therapeutic diet 
  • Stage 3: Creatinine 2.9-5.0 mg/dL, obvious symptoms, add phosphate binders, fluids, blood pressure control 
  • Stage 4: Creatinine >5.0 mg/dL, life-threatening, aggressive management or palliative care

Sub-staging by proteinuria (UPC <0.2, 0.2-0.4, >0.4) and blood pressure (<150, 150-179, ≥180 mmHg) indicates more aggressive disease.

Treatment intensity escalates by stage. Cornell research shows cats starting therapeutic diets at Stage 2 progress slower than those beginning later.

Should I Feed a Prescription Kidney Diet?
What does the research show and what makes kidney diets work?

Kidney diets provide reduced phosphorus (slows progression), moderately restricted high-quality protein (reduces waste), omega-3 fatty acids (anti-inflammatory), alkalinizing agents (counteracts acidosis), and controlled sodium (manages blood pressure).

IRIS guidelines recommend therapeutic diets for Stage 2 or higher (creatinine ≥1.6 mg/dL). Common options: Hill’s k/d, Royal Canin Renal Support, Purina NF.

How do I transition my cat to kidney food?

Gradual transition over 2-3 weeks: Week 1 (75% current/25% kidney), Week 2 (50/50), Week 3 (25/75), Week 4 (100% kidney). Never force-feed therapeutic diets.

  • If your cat refuses: Try different brands and textures, warm food to body temperature, mix with low-sodium broth (vet-approved), hand-feed initially, try elevated bowls. If persistent refusal continues after multiple attempts, discuss homemade renal diets or feeding tubes with your veterinarian.
  • Critical insight: Appetite preservation proves more important than perfect diet compliance. A cat eating maintenance food maintains better body condition than a cat refusing therapeutic food and losing weight.

How Do I Manage Medications for CKD?
What medications treat kidney disease and how do I time them?
  • Phosphate binders (aluminum hydroxide, calcium carbonate, lanthanum): Give WITH meals for effectiveness
  • Blood pressure medications (amlodipine 0.625-1.25 mg daily): Same time daily, target <160 mmHg to prevent kidney damage and retinal detachment
  • Potassium supplementation (potassium gluconate/citrate 2-6 mEq daily): Prevents muscle weakness and appetite loss from hypokalemia
  • Appetite stimulants (mirtazapine 1.88-3.75 mg every 2-3 days, maropitant 1 mg/kg daily): Give 30-60 minutes before meals
  • Erythropoietin (EPO): For Stage 4 anemia (hematocrit <20%), injections 2-3x weekly, expensive but improves quality of life significantly
  • Anti-nausea medications (maropitant, ondansetron): Uremia causes significant nausea impacting appetite

What About Subcutaneous Fluids?
When are fluids necessary and how do they work?

Stage 3-4 CKD often requires supplemental hydration when dehydration persists despite free water access or elevated creatinine despite diet. Lactated Ringer’s solution or saline injected under skin creates fluid pockets absorbing over 4-8 hours, supporting hydration and toxin flushing.

  • Administration: 100-150 ml per session, 2-3x weekly (Stage 3) to daily (Stage 4), injected at scruff between shoulder blades.
  • Making it easier: Warm fluids to body temperature, use 18-20 gauge needles for faster flow, hang bag above cat for gravity assist, create routine with same time/location, give high-value treats immediately after, consider two-person administration initially.
  • Realistic expectations: Not all cats tolerate home fluids equally. Warning signs of excessive stress include hiding for hours after, aggressive behavior, stopped eating/grooming, fear of administration area. Discuss quality of life with your veterinarian—the goal is comfort, not prolonging suffering.

How Can I Increase My Cat's Water Intake?

Even modest hydration improvements provide measurable benefits.

Proven strategies: Multiple water stations (3-4 minimum throughout house, fresh twice daily), water fountains (movement attracts cats, oxygenates water), wide shallow bowls (prevents whisker fatigue, ceramic/stainless steel preferred, away from litter boxes), wet food (70-80% moisture vs. 10% in kibble—most impactful intervention), vet-approved flavor enhancement (low-sodium chicken broth, tuna water, broth ice cubes).

Monitoring: Measure water added daily, subtract remaining = consumption. Track trends over weeks. Normal cats drink 40-60 ml per kg daily; CKD cats often 100+ ml per kg. Gradually increasing intake signals progression.

What Monitoring Does My Cat Need?

Veterinary visit frequency:

  • Stage 1-2: Blood work, urinalysis, blood pressure every 6 months; monthly home weight checks
  • Stage 3: Blood work, urinalysis, blood pressure every 3 months; weekly home weight checks
  • Stage 4: Monthly blood work, urinalysis, blood pressure; daily home monitoring

Blood work tracks: Creatinine (filtration), BUN (waste), SDMA (early detection), phosphorus (diet/binder effectiveness, targets by stage: 2 <4.5, 3 <5.0, 4 <6.0 mg/dL), potassium (supplementation need), hematocrit (anemia), total protein/albumin (nutrition).

Urinalysis reveals: Urine specific gravity (concentration ability: normal >1.035, CKD often <1.020), protein levels (UPC ratio quantifies damage), bacteria/WBCs (UTI common in CKD).

Home monitoring: Track appetite (full/half/refused meals), water consumption (bowl refills), urination frequency (clump count), vomiting (frequency/timing), energy level, weekly body weight (5% loss over 2-4 weeks warrants vet contact).

Why Do CKD Cats Seem Stable Then Suddenly Deteriorate?

Blood work shows “unchanged” creatinine for months, then everything collapses seemingly overnight.

Why this happens: Remaining nephrons compensate aggressively until they exhaust simultaneously. Interventions today may not show blood work effects for 4-6 weeks while damage now only becomes visible months later. CKD progresses nonlinearly—long plateaus followed by stepwise declines when compensation fails. Single data points mislead; trends over months matter more. Stacking stressors (heat + reduced water + household stress) trigger rapid decompensation.

Early warning signs: Appetite decreasing from full to partial meals, water intake increasing 20-30% over 2-4 weeks, vomiting frequency doubling, energy declining, weight decreasing 3-5% over month. These often precede creatinine increases by weeks.

Can Anything Reverse or Cure CKD?

No. Chronic kidney disease represents irreversible nephron loss. Dead kidney tissue doesn’t regenerate. Treatment slows progression, manages symptoms, maintains quality of life, and extends survival (sometimes years), but cannot cure.

Stability IS success. When blood values remain unchanged for 6-12 months, treatment is working. The goal isn’t improvement, but preventing decline.

How Do I Take Care of a Cat With CKD?

The most difficult aspect involves recognizing when treatment burden outweighs quality of life.

  • Honest questions: More good days than bad? Still engaging in favorite activities (even modified)? Eating voluntarily? Pain-free (not hiding, vocalizing, showing distress)? Responding positively to treatment?
  • Signs treatment may not be enough: Persistent vomiting despite medication, complete appetite loss for multiple days, severe lethargy (no interaction), uremic seizures, uncontrolled hypertension causing blindness, severe anemia causing weakness, requires daily hospitalization, needs feeding tube for all nutrition, shows distress during necessary treatments.
  • Hospice/palliative care: Focus shifts from prolonging life to maintaining comfort. Continue symptom management (nausea, pain), discontinue interventions causing distress, prioritize favorite foods over therapeutic diets, emphasize comfort over compliance.

Bring specific data to veterinary discussions: vomiting frequency, days food refused, activity changes, treatment response.
